What a head gasket does in the Chevrolet Cruze

A head gasket is a critical seal that sits between the engine block and the cylinder head. In a Chevrolet Cruze, it performs multiple jobs at once: it keeps the combustion chamber isolated, prevents coolant from entering the pistons, and stops oil from leaking into the cooling system or cylinders. When the head gasket functions correctly, heat and pressure are contained, allowing the engine to run smoothly. If the gasket weakens or fails, you may notice mixing of fluids, overheating, or loss of compression. For Cruze owners, a healthy head gasket is essential for reliable cold starts, steady idle, and predictable power delivery. Common failure modes for the Cruze head gasket

Head gasket failures in the Cruze typically arise from overheating, improper maintenance, or manufacturing variances in older assemblies. Overheating past the point of tolerance can cause the gasket to warp or crack, creating pathways for cross leakage. Repeated poor maintenance—such as ignoring coolant level or failing to address a clogged radiator—accelerates the deterioration. In turbocharged variants, higher cylinder pressure adds stress. A failure path often begins with minor coolant loss, then gradual oil contamination, followed by cross-contamination symptoms that worsen with heat and load.

Symptoms of a blown head gasket in a Cruze

Look for a combination of signs rather than a single telltale symptom. Common indicators include white steam or smoke from the exhaust, milky oil on the dipstick, coolant loss without an external leak, overheating under load, or bubbles in the radiator when the system is hot. In some Cruze models, you may see exhaust gases in the cooling system or rough idle and misfires due to compromised combustion sealing. If you notice any of these symptoms, perform a diagnostic check promptly to prevent further engine damage.

Diagnosing head gasket problems: steps and tests

A thorough diagnosis should start with a visual inspection of the cooling system, oil, and exhaust. Perform a compression test on all cylinders to check for uniform compression; low readings can indicate a compromised seal. A leak-down test helps locate the exact leakage path. A chemical test for exhaust gases in the coolant can confirm combustion gases in the cooling system. If results are inconclusive, consider a thermal imaging test to spot abnormal heat patterns under load. Remember to rule out simpler causes first, such as a faulty thermostat, water pump, or cracked hoses, before assuming a gasket failure.

Repair options for the Chevrolet Cruze head gasket

Repair approaches vary by damage severity and engine type. In many cases, a full head gasket replacement is required, which involves removing the cylinder head, inspecting for warpage, resurfacing if necessary, and replacing the gasket with the correct torque sequence. A more limited option may be to perform a gasket sealant repair in some older or low-load engines, but this is generally temporary and not a substitute for a full replacement. For turbo or high-performance variants, ensure proper cooling and boost control are addressed to prevent recurrence. Always use OEM or high-quality aftermarket gaskets and follow the recommended torque specs and sequence.

Maintenance to prevent gasket failures

Preventive maintenance saves money and headaches. Regularly inspect the cooling system for leaks, replace aging hoses, and keep coolant at the correct level and mix. Maintain proper oil changes, use the right coolant type, and monitor for signs of overheating or misfiring. In turbo engines, ensure the cooling system and intercooling are functioning correctly to prevent heat soak. A well-maintained cooling and lubrication strategy extends gasket life and protects the engine’s integrity.
